Abstract :
The Varshamov-Tenengol´ts codes are binary number-theoretic codes that can correct a single asymmetric error. Levenshtein realised that this same construction can correct a single insertion/deletion error. And yet asymmetric and insertion/deletion errors appear to be fundamentally different. This paper explores this scenario. Constantin and Rao showed that any Abelian group of order n + 1 can correct a single asymmetric error. In this paper, we show that only a subset of Abelian groups can correct a single insertion/deletion error.
